I've got a Dynamic on order with panoramic roof, automatic, privacy glass and service pack. Due to get it next month (been waiting a few months so far!)

I spoke to my local dealer and they weren't too helpful on the price. So went further afield and managed to negotiate a better price, so they will discount, but not by a lot! Too many people want to buy them so they don't need to offer big discounts.

My first consideration was a second hand Sport, or maybe even a newer Evoque but the residuals on the Evoques are far too high at the minute, it worked out cheaper and better overall to buy a brand new one. Less to worry about etc.

I am a bit concerned that the high residuals are nearing the end and the price might drop soon, but as mentioned earlier in the thread, there are plenty of people who want these cars and are willing to pay, so hopefully it'll last a few more years yet. I'm sure that won't even come into my mind when I'm driving it smile

It is expensive for an SUV but I think it's worth it, the RR is a step above any other car I've driven. Back to back a RR and a Ford Kuga and you'll want the RR every time (provided you're willing to pay twice as much biggrin)

Hi guys can anyone tell me what the "intergrated approach lights" are or how they work? I don't have adaptive xenons (normal ones I believe) but my spec sheets States these approach lights?

Thanks in advance.

They are the lights that project from the wing mirrors to the floor in the dark when you unlock/lock car, they project a light with a RR evoque outline in it.
